I looked it up. It turns out that black bears (incidentally, I have only ever seen the cat/bear thing occur with black bears), the wild ones that haven't had contact with people anyway, tend to be a bundle of nerves. If you give them an excuse, they will run rather than fight. Meanwhile, when cats get worked up they will fight more or less anything, rather than run. It may also have to do with cats being territorial, while bears generally aren't; a cat who doesn't stand its ground won't have any left, while a bear can just keep ramblin' on.
I also have a theory that cats don't smell like anything bears normally eat, but that a wandering bear is probably curious, and doesn't require much more than a swat to decide there's less painful things to investigate further on down the road; meanwhile domestic cats have lived their whole lives not giving any fucks and aren't about to start for the potential new neighbour.
